Transaction 17e508c370d93c0463bb9f11b16ab0c8520ce6518913268b3a176458d5caeccc
1 Input
1 Output
-
17e508c370d93c0463bb9f11b16ab0c8520ce6518913268b3a176458d5caeccc:0
- value
- 589673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c6ec57a52778820714c6f015b2ee3b664a2d580 OP_EQUAL
- address
- 3EVZDvzM3gejz6h4Zy7rHnzdsF8w3YNanT